The size of Runcorn is approximately 6.5 square kilometres. It has 31 parks covering nearly 19.6% of total area. The population of Runcorn in 2016 was 14592 people. By 2021 the population was 14199 showing a population decline of 2.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Runcorn is 30-39 years. Households in Runcorn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Runcorn work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 59.60% of the homes in Runcorn were owner-occupied compared with 60.80% in 2016.
